    Aromatherapy for Depression

    Friday, July 4, 2008, 07:58 AM EST [Oils, Herbs, Aromatherapy]

    Aromatherapy uses aromatic essences that are extracted from plants. The essential oils are like the plant's hormones: They control its biochemical reactions and relay messages between cells; they also protect the plant from parasites, bacteria, and fungi. They are the most vital substance of the plant.

    Essential oils are very potent, and many are too strong to use directly on the skin. If you use them for massage, add them to massage oil or cream, and experiment with the amount to use. Even in a bath, too much of a particular oil could be irritating to your skin. Begin by using just a few drops. If you like the effect, you can gradually add a bit more if you wish.

    Some oils can counteract homeopathic remedies, so be sure to check with a homeopath if you are using both treatments simultaneously.

    Aromatherapy can help in mild forms of depression. It may ease mental fatigue and help with sleep. However, if you, or someone you know, are severely depressed, additional support and therapy are necessary. Aromatherapy is more effective when used as a complimentary therapy, assisting other therapies.

    Essential oils used for depression are basil, bergamot, cedarwood, clary sage, frankincense, geranium, grapefruit, lavender, lemon, jasmine, myrrh, neroli, rose, sandalwood, spruce, orange, and ylang ylang.

    Essential oils that can have a positive influence on feelings of anger, which are associated with depression,  include rose, chamomile, ylang ylang, and rosemary.

    If the depression is associated with a loss, then essential oils helpful for grief and bereavement, such as lavender, rose, frankincense, neroli, hyssop, and marjoram, should be included.

    Many of the essential oils used for depression are from flowers and fruit. These essences have an uplifting effect on the mind and emotions.

    Inhalation blend for mild depression

    4 parts Clary sage essential oil

    4 parts Ylang ylang essential oil

    3 parts Geranium essential oil

    2 parts Basil essential oil

    1 part Sandalwood essential oil

    Mix the above essential oils in an amber glass bottle, Label. Use three to four times daily.

    Essential Oil Blend for Depression

    Basil

    Clary sage

    Jasmine

    Rose

    German chamomile (matricaria recutita)

    Mix the oil together. Place it in a bowl of steaming water (2 or 3 drops), or in a bath (5 or 6 drops ), or on the edge of your pillow (1 or 2 drops).

    Aromatherapy Bath

    An aromatic bath two to three times per week is especially helpful for depression. Sometimes the aromatic baths are effective enough on their own as a remedy for mild bouts of depression or feeling blue.

    Aromatic Bath for the Blues

    For mild bouts of depression

    1/4 cup Honey (or almond, canola, soy and safflower)

    3 drops Lavender essential oil

    3 drops Ylang ylang essential oil

    2 drops Basil essential oil

    2 drops Geranium essential oil

    1 drop Grapefruit essential oil

    Mix the essential oils in the honey. Fill the bath tub with warm water and then add the aromatic honey mixture. Stir well using your hands. Soak for 20 to 30 minutes.

    Aromatherapy Massage

    An aromatherapy massage is one of the best ways you can treat yourself It is pampering and nurturing, in addition to very satisfying. Massage and aromatherapy go hand in hand in treating nervous system ailments such as depression.

    Elation Formulation

    A concentrated massage oil for mild depression

    2 tblsp. sweet almond oil (or vegetable oil)

    1 tsp. Wheat germ oil

    8 drops Lavender essential oil

    8 drops Ylang ylang essential oil

    2 drops Basil essential oil

    2 drops Geranium essential oil

    2 drops Bergamot essential oil

    Collect the essential oils in an amber glass bottle. Add the sweet almond oil and wheat germ oil. Shake gently and mix well.

    Apply a small amount onto the back of the hands and chest area. Inhale the essences from your hands after application to the skin. Apply two or three times daily.

    Kinds of Faeries

    Tuesday, July 1, 2008, 07:41 AM EST [Faeries]

    BUTTERFLY FAERIES: They are also known as the moss people for they are experts at hiding in mossy, dark areas. Butterfly Faeries come from Switzerland, Germany, Africa, and from the Islands. These delicate, slender spirits have beautifully colored butterfly wings emanating from their bodies. They are very shy and human sightings of them are very rare indeed. They avoid human contact as much possible for they do not trust mankind, who has been destroying their forest homes. They are often confused for real butterflies because they often play with their best friends: monarch butterflies. They usually do not trust humans, but if a butterfly Faery befriends you, she or he will prove to be a true friend to you for life by always bringing you good luck. If you should see a butterfly Faery, do not make any sudden movements. Let her know you want to be friends, and you mean her no harm. Remember, it is very important for us to protect the disappearing forest, the favorite home of these very special creatures. 

    CLOUD FAERIES: Cloud Faeries emerge as large formations in masses of clouds. They look like long humans. The cloud Faeries help you with your imagination and creation of the arts. They themselves are master sculptors making wonderful images out of air and water. To call a cloud Faery to you, it is best to summon one around sunset or sunrise, for they use the elements of both in order to create beauty. Call to them when you are about to make any form of art. If your mind and heart are open to hearing them, they will help you. 

    DRYADS (a.k.a. Tree spirits, Tree Ladies, Druidesses, Hamadryads, Sidhe Draoi): These Faeries live all over the world, but originate from the Celtic countries. Even though they live in and protect the trees, their element is air. Their favorite time of the month is at the full moon. They are excellent musicians and will often play their strange magical, musical instruments while they dance, sing, and laugh under the light of the moon. They will not harm you if you follow their music, but it may cause you to spend too much time in Faeryland. These spirits are only female. They are usual seen as wisps of light. The dryads are very playful and do like to tease, but if they befriend you, they will help you get in touch with your magical abilities and to contact your divine energy. To find them it is best to go to a grove of sacred trees. You may find this beautiful spirit in a willow, oak, ash, thorn, rowan, birch, or elder tree. 

    EARTH FAERIES: Earth Faeries are very small, standing about a foot to eighteen inches tall. They are often a golden brown or dark green color. Sometimes they come into view as bear-type creatures. Earth Faeries live in communities and are very friendly. These spirits work very hard dealing with the well being of all creatures, humans and Faeries alike. Even though the Earth Faeries love mortals very much, they often lose their patience with the humans for their foolishness and careless treatment of Mother Earth. Earth Faeries love colorful rocks in their natural state, but will also cut the stones to show off the inner beauty. When we call them into our circle, they can help you plant your feet firmly on the ground, and like the stones, help you to find the inner beauty that you hold inside of you. 

    FLOWER FAERIES: These are the peaceful spirits of the earth. These wee folk are a very passionate people. They are in love with natural beauty and luxury, and love nothing more than to array themselves with beautiful flowers and things of nature. They are whimsical, willful, and beautiful. They befriend the kind-of-heart but will stay away from those who are greedy and selfish. They love wine and sweets. Leave some at a place where wild flowers grow. Any gentle acts of kindness help encourage the Faeries to make a blessing. So if you are kind, you will be a blessing on the Earth.

    Weed the Garden Ritual

    Wednesday, June 25, 2008, 06:44 AM EST [Gardening]

     



    Time to weed the garden? You can weed and do magic at the same time. Start by thinking about what you want to get rid of in your life, and perhaps in the world. Then, go into your garden, equipped to weed with kneepads, hoe, fork, and the like. As you pull each weed, name it, and say these words:


    I remove hate,
    I remove poverty.
    I remove my anger at my boss.

    And so on. Be creative in your designs. Afterward, be sure to dispose of the weeds carefully. Either bag them and put them into the garbage immediately, knowing they are going away, or if you compost, ask the Earth to transform them as they rot.
